AI Contract Overview
The contract pertains to the procurement of 11 piston rings, identified by NSN 4310-12-355-2433, under solicitation SPE7M1-26-T-229S, issued by the Defense Logistics Agency on behalf of the Department of Defense’s Maritime Supply Chain. The procurement is a total small business set-aside under NAICS code 333912, with strict compliance requirements for technical and quality specifications outlined in the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, referenced by R or I numbers. The product must be manufactured and supplied in strict adherence to packaging standards MIL-STD-2073-1E and marking standards MIL-STD-129, with unit packaging in a fiberboard box and intermediate plastic bag containment, and no preservation or wrapping materials used. The item is designated as a critical application component, with specific approved part numbers from Sauer Compressors USA and J.P. Sauer Sohn Maschinenbau GmbH explicitly listed. Mercury or mercury-containing compounds are prohibited from intentional addition or direct contact with the hardware, except for defined exceptions such as functional uses in batteries, instruments, or weapon systems as specified by NAVSEA, and any portable devices containing mercury must include shockproof design and a secondary containment boundary. Delivery is due 168 days after award, with FOB origin terms, meaning title and risk transfer to the government at the contractor’s facility, and final inspection and acceptance occur at the destination, DDSP New Cumberland Facility in Pennsylvania. The contract mandates electronic invoicing through WAWF and includes clauses on combating human trafficking, employment eligibility verification, hazardous material identification, sustainable products, cybersecurity requirements, and prohibition of hexavalent chromium and toxic material storage, all subject to deviations under 2026-00038. Contractors must provide UEI and CAGE codes, affirm small business status, and disclose any covered defense telecommunications equipment or services. All submissions are required via DIBBS, with no amendments issued at time of solicitation, and pricing data for the current CLIN remains unspecified in the solicitation, though historical pricing for other items is noted as non-applicable to this award.
